offices are looking for a Senior Electrical Engineer to join the Design Services Group. As a member of the multidisciplinary design team, the Electrical Engineer will work on a broad spectrum of electrical aspects for multiple projects, including new installations, upgrades of existing systems, testing, commissioning, and system optimization. This person must have a solid understanding of low and medium voltage power distribution design, motor control concepts and functionality, electrical system protection and control, standby power options and implementation, detailed design work, construction contract administration and support, and commissioning activities for water and wastewater treatment plants, industrial plants, solid waste and non-utility power generation plants in municipal and industrial sectors.
Quick adaptation to different clients’ design standards is a must.
